Evolution of Pixel A phones 

There have been 19 different Google Pixel generations with the newest generation. Google Pixel was the first phone in the Pixel line, launching in October 2016. At the time, this was one of the first smartphones to take advantage of USB-C, with the device also packing in a 12.3 megapixel camera. 

Google Pixel 2 was released in October 2017 with some significant improvements to the camera system, including support for optical image stabilization. 

The Google Pixel 3 made many noticeable changes for users. First, the bezels surrounding the display were drastically slimmed down compared to both Google Pixel and Google Pixel 2. As a result, the resolution of the screen was also made higher, with an increase of 12.5% and a shift to a 5.5″ display. 

Google offered mid-range smartphones to the market, with the Google Pixel 3a in 2019. It was a cheaper companion to the flagship Google Pixel 3. 

Google Pixel 4 was focused much more on internals. Google improved the refresh rate of the display to 90Hz, and there were numerous upgrades made to the camera system such as a 2x optical zoom. Pixel 4a made huge improvements with display brightness, delivering a peak brightness of 796 nits – an 83% increase over Pixel 4. 

Google Pixel 5 made battery life a major priority, providing a 4080mAh battery that delivered almost 50% more battery life per charge over Google Pixel 4. The Google Pixel 5 and Pixel 5a almost look identical next to each other, but the 5a actually sports a slightly bigger display of 6.34″. 

Google introduced a fresh design with Pixel 6 in October 2021. Despite all the new technology integrated inside the device, Pixel 6 actually launched for $100 less than Pixel 5. The Google Pixel 6a launched later than most other a models, arriving in late July 2022. This smartphone cut the 90Hz refresh rate of Google Pixel 6 to 60Hz, in addition to the RAM from 8GB to 6GB. 

Google Pixel 7 was a minimal upgrade, while at least still refining some of the Pixel’s most used features. Launched in October 2022, the Pixel 7 brought an improved fingerprint sensor, a redesigned camera bar, and better performance. 

Google Pixel 7a was launched on May 10, 2023. It brought a 64MP main camera and kept the 90Hz refresh rate and 8GB of RAM. The 7a is a bit smaller than the Pixel 7 despite still retaining a similar screen size. 

Google made its first major shakeup to the Pixel lineup in 2023 with Google Pixel Fold. This foldable phone features a huge 7.6″ display when folded open, with a standard display on the outside so you can use it like any normal smartphone. 

Google Pixel 8 was a decent upgrade from the Pixel 7 line, with some major features being a peak brightness of 2000 nits and a refresh rate of 120Hz. Google Pixel 8a was launched on May 14, 2024. This model dropped the Gorilla Glass Victus, opting for Gorilla Glass 3 on the display. While both have an OLED display and sport similar performance, the real difference was in the cameras. 

Google Pixel 9 was launched in August 2024. This broke from a years-long tradition of launching new Pixel flagship models in October. The Google Pixel 9 Pro Fold features a foldable display that builds off the 2023 Pixel Fold. The display is now taller and thinner, allowing for a bigger screen on the device. 

The Google Pixel 9a features a 6.3-inch Actual display that is 35% brighter than its predecessor and is powered by the Google Tensor G4.  

The new Pixel 10, Pixel 10 Pro, and Pixel 10 Pro XL were released on August 28. These new phones also featured the more powerful Tensor G5 chip and come with some UI updates as well.

Samsung TV Buying Guide 

What is LED?  

LED stands for light-emitting diode and simply refers to the backlight that lights up your TV. But not all LED TVs are created equal – the technology around them varies, and so too will your picture quality. This is why OLED and QLED TVs are seen as superior displays. With standard LED TVs, you’ll find big differences not only in the number of LEDs but the quality of each LED. This can lead to big differences in colour, contrasts, and the brightness of pictures you see on TV. 

What is an OLED TV? 

OLED stands for organic light-emitting diode. Unlike standard LED TVs, which use a backlight to produce colours, OLEDs produce both light and colour from a single diode or pixel. Their ability to be self-illuminating means they produce ‘real’ blacks. Deeper blacks allow for higher contrasts and richer colours, which in turn leads to a more natural and realistic image.  

This innovation means that OLED TVs no longer need a separate backlight and instead produce bright, colourful pictures from individually operated pixels. 

What is Neo QLED? 

Samsung Neo QLED technology is an advancement of Samsung’s QLED technology. Samsung’s Neo QLED range boasts Quantum Mini LEDs. These are only 1/40th of the size of traditional LEDs – approximately the size of a grain of sand. These lights are expertly controlled, so you get better contrast and detail across the screen.  

And, since their size means the TV can fit more Mini LEDs in, Neo QLED TVs have a higher brightness level and exceptional picture quality on every inch of the screen. The light from Quantum Dots is now even more efficient, allowing Neo QLED TVs to be brighter, richer and more colour accurate compared to previous models

Best Samsung TVs in 2026 

Samsung S95F OLED 

The Samsung S95F OLED is the best Samsung TV. Like any OLED, you get unrivaled black levels, so blacks are deep and inky in a dark room. Since it uses a QD-OLED panel, you also get incredibly bright and vibrant colors that can’t be matched by traditional WOLED displays. A lot of OLED models don’t fare well in bright rooms, but this TV is the only OLED on the market that features a matte screen coating.  

Reflections are almost invisible on this TV, so overhead lights and even direct light sources facing the screen are non-factor. Combined with its amazing peak brightness, visibility isn’t an issue at all on this TV. Another positive is that it has a very wide viewing angle, so it’s great for group settings. It comes with Samsung’s unique Slim One Connect Box, which gives you quick access to the inputs when the TV is wall mounted and offers versatility for your setup. 

The TV is also equipped with a plethora of modern gaming features like four HDMI 2.1 ports, 4k @ 165Hz, and VRR, making it a great option for pairing with modern consoles and gaming PCs. It also has nearly instant pixel transitions, so motion is crisp and clear.  

In addition to that, it has exceptionally low input lag for a responsive feel. Home theater enthusiasts may be put off by Samsung’s lack of Dolby Vision and DTS audio passthrough, but if you can live without those features, the S95F is one of the best TVs on the market. 

Samsung S90F OLED 

Samsung S90F OLED comes in, which is the best Samsung TV in the upper mid-range category. Being a QD-OLED, you still get the same perfect black levels and similarly vibrant colors as its older sibling. You also get impressive HDR brightness, so HDR content is impactful. Unfortunately, the TV isn’t nearly as bright in SDR as the S95F, and it’s not nearly as good with reflection handling due to its glossy coating, so there are some visibility issues in bright rooms.  

Still, you can watch TV and not be distracted by glare in moderately lit rooms. You also get the same wide viewing angle as the more expensive model, so it’s great for wide seating arrangements. 

Despite not offering 165Hz support, you can still game in up to 4k @ 144Hz with VRR on any of its four HDMI 2.1 ports. The TV has the same nearly instant pixel transitions and low input lag, so you get a sharp and smooth gaming experience.  

Like any Samsung TV, it doesn’t support Dolby Vision or DTS audio passthrough, but it still offers HDR10+. If you’re considering this TV, just keep in mind that only some sizes have a QD-OLED panel, and even that varies by region. 

Samsung S85F OLED 

If you want an OLED, but the two picks above are out of your price range, consider the Samsung S85F OLED. It’s not as bright as the Samsung S90F OLED, and it caps out at 4k @ 120Hz, but outside of that, the two TVs are remarkably similar. You still get the perfect black levels, vivid colors, wide viewing angle, and the nearly instant response times QD-OLEDs are known for.  

Even though the TV isn’t as bright as its more expensive siblings, you can still watch SDR content in a room with a few lights on and not be distracted by reflections. There’s a larger disparity in HDR brightness compared to the other two Samsung OLEDs, so highlights in dark scenes and entirely well-lit scenes don’t pop out as much, but you still get a decently impactful HDR experience. 

Some PC gamers might feel like they’re missing out by not having a 144Hz refresh rate, but the TV still offers four HDMI 2.1 ports capable of 4k @ 120Hz with VRR, so the TV is fully compatible with the features offered by modern consoles.  

Unfortunately, like the S90F, there’s a catch. In North America, only the 55-inch and 65-inch models use a QD-OLED panel, whereas the larger options utilize a normal WOLED panel. The rest of the world gets a WOLED panel throughout all size options. You can determine what type of panel it has by looking at the model code. 

Samsung QN80F 

Samsung QN80F is the best lower mid-range Samsung TV. It’s a lot brighter than the Samsung S85F OLED in SDR, so it overcomes more glare in a well-lit room. Although the Samsung has local dimming to help deepen blacks, you don’t get anything close to the inky blacks you get from OLEDs, and there’s haloing around highlights.  

It has about the same HDR brightness as the S85F, but since its contrast ratio is much lower and it doesn’t display as wide a range of colors, HDR content doesn’t look as good on it. The TV’s viewing angle is pretty narrow, so it’s not as good for wide seating arrangements as the OLEDs above. 

Fortunately, it has HDMI 2.1 bandwidth, up to 4k @ 144Hz, and VRR, so it pairs excellently with modern gaming consoles. The TV’s input lag is low on this model, but pixel response times are a lot slower than they are on OLEDs, so fast motion is a bit blurry. Like almost any Samsung model, it supports HDR10+, which helps HDR content look as good as it can on this model 

Samsung Q7F 

The Samsung Q7F is the best budget Samsung TV available. Samsung doesn’t release many budget models anymore, and the ones they do release tend to have mediocre image quality. That’s the case here, as the Q7F doesn’t have local dimming to help deepen blacks, which leads to dark scenes looking washed out. The TV is also too dim to handle much glare at all in a room with the lights on, so it’s best suited for a dimly lit environment.  

Its lack of brightness also means that HDR content looks underwhelming, since highlights don’t stand out like they should. Colors are also more muted on this TV, and the image lacks vibrancy. Like the Samsung QN80F, it has a narrow viewing angle, so it’s best viewed from directly in front of the screen. 

Unfortunately, this is a 60Hz TV that’s pretty bare-bones in terms of gaming features. It doesn’t have VRR to reduce screen tearing, and motion is blurry due to its slow pixel response times. However, 4k @ 60Hz gaming has decently low input lag, so at least gaming feels responsive.  

You still get HDR10+, which makes HDR content look a bit better, but that format doesn’t save this TV from looking underwhelming. If you really want a budget Samsung TV, it’s not the worst choice, but most people are better off shopping for a budget model from brands like TCL and Hisense.

Downsides of Samsung TVs 

Uniformity issues. 

Samsung models typically don’t have the best gray uniformity and have some dirty screen effect, which could get distracting during sports or PC use. 

TVs can be costly, and may not offer good value. 

Samsung’s high-end TVs can get costly, so while they provide the best performance, they may not have the best value compared to other brands. There are often cheaper TVs that you can get with no compromises. 

Few budget models. 

Although Samsung used to offer a wide range of budget models, in recent years, they’ve really scaled down their budget lineup. Their budget models typically aren’t worth buying when you can get better picture quality and performance from companies like Hisense and TCL. 

No Dolby Vision or DTS audio support. 

Although Samsung has their own dynamic HDR format in HDR10+, none of their TVs support the more widely used Dolby Vision format. They also don’t include support for advanced DTS audio formats, which are prevalent in physical media. 

What You Should Know Before Buying a Samsung TV? 

Samsung’s lineup covers everything from budget to high-end models. As a rule of thumb, the higher the number, the better it is, although sometimes the improvements aren’t worth it. Samsung releases four main TV lineups, and they use a consistent naming scheme for the top three lineups, which makes it very easy to understand what you’re buying simply by looking at the model number. 

Samsung uses the prefix ‘Q’ to denote their mid-range QLED models, and the last letter of these models also reflects the model year. They introduced the Mini LED lineup in 2021, denoted by the prefix ‘QN’ in the model name, like the Samsung QN90D. Their entry-level models follow a slightly different naming structure in 2025, with a single ‘Q’ used to identify their lower-end options. For example, the Q7F is a normal LED model without features like local dimming.

Core Technology Explained  

Samsung OLED Glare Free features an exclusive matte coating solution on QD-OLED devices, which was initially used on the S95D lineup released in 2024. Samsung’s OLED Glare Free features an analogous hard coating layer on its QD-OLED devices that contain minute textures on the surface, effectively scattering incident light and turning sharp reflections into blurry and soft haze. This is different from traditional matte coating solutions due to its maintenance of OLED’s color depth and brightness, as seen in its compatibility with HDR content 

The tech was initially branded as “OLED Glare Free” before it advanced to “Glare Free 2.0” in 2025 models such as the S95F. It achieves a 30% increase in brightness while reducing glare by a significant amount. Samsung offers it along with Quantum Dot to deliver Pantone certification in terms of color accuracy while maintaining it without losing contrast or saturation.
